LOUISVILLE, Ky. (WDRB) -- A local 8-year-old is headed to the BMX Racing World Championships.

Madden Atherton, who attends St. Albert the Great Parish School, is one of 30 8-year-olds in the country headed to Rock Hill, South Carolina, to compete for the U.S.

His father, William Atherton, who is the president of the nonprofit Derby City BMX in Louisville, said the championship is one step below the Olympics.

"He's just one of those kids that pushes hard and he gets it," Atherton said.

Madden is currently the only national rider in the state of Kentucky. 

"I just want to have fun and stay on my bike," he said.

The Athertons plan to leave Thursday morning for South Carolina. To celebrate, Madden's class held a U.S.A. sendoff for him Wednesday afternoon.

The BMX Racing World Championships start next week.
